Versions 1 and 2 of the Skypunch API will be deprecated on July 7, 2023 leaving only version 3 remaining. Applications pointing to earlier versions of the API will need to make the necessary updates to version 3 and also ensure that any changes to existing version 3 endpoints are capable of handling the responses.
